Kidney stones are a common yet painful condition that affects millions of people worldwide. They form when certain substances in the urine, such as calcium, oxalate, and uric acid, become concentrated and crystallize. What is Magnesium Malate?

Magnesium malate is a compound made up of magnesium and malic acid, which is found in various fruits and is involved in the energy production process in the body. Magnesium is an essential mineral that plays a vital role in many bodily functions, including muscle function, nerve transmission, and bone health. Malic acid, on the other hand, is known for its potential benefits in energy metabolism and reducing muscle fatigue.

How Magnesium Affects Kidney Stones

Research suggests that magnesium may play a protective role in preventing the formation of kidney stones. Here’s how:

1. Regulation of Calcium Levels

High levels of calcium in the urine are a significant risk factor for calcium-based kidney stones. Magnesium helps regulate calcium levels in the body, potentially leading to lower urinary calcium concentrations. This may reduce the likelihood of stone formation.

2. Oxalate Binding

Oxalate is another compound that can contribute to kidney stone formation, particularly calcium oxalate stones. Some studies suggest that magnesium can bind to oxalate in the intestines, preventing its absorption and subsequent excretion in urine. By lowering oxalate levels, magnesium may help reduce the risk of stone development.

3. pH Balance

Magnesium malate can help maintain a healthy urinary pH balance. A more alkaline urine environment can prevent the crystallization of certain stone-forming substances, thus reducing the risk of kidney stones.

Natural Sources of Magnesium

In addition to supplements, you can increase your magnesium intake through dietary sources. Foods rich in magnesium include:

– Leafy greens (spinach, kale)
– Nuts and seeds (almonds, pumpkin seeds)
– Whole grains (brown rice, quinoa)
– Legumes (black beans, lentils)
– Fish (salmon, mackerel)
